The minimum growth wage will automatically increase by 2.65% on May 1 due to the high inflation recorded since November, the Ministry of Labor announced on Friday, April 15. For a full-time job, the monthly minimum wage will be 1,645.58 euros gross. The gross hourly minimum wage will raise from 10.57 euros to 10.85 euros.
In France, the purchasing power of minimum wage workers is protected by an automatic revaluation mechanism enshrined in law, which ensures that the minimum wage increases at least as fast as inflation affecting the most modest households. According to the final results of the consumer price index in March published by INSEE, inflation between November 2021 and March 2022 stands at 2.65% for the 20% of households with the lowest incomes. The minimum wage will therefore be increased in the same proportions.
